//单点修改、区间查询int t[maxn]={0}; void build_tree(int node,int start,int end) { if(start==end) { t[node]=a[start]; return ; } int left=2*node+1; //左节点的坐标 in... ...
分类:
其他好文 时间:
2019-08-28 11:20:07
阅读次数:
76
1、用例关联:就是各个用例之间的关系,分3种关系分别是:包含关系、扩展关系、泛化关系。 2、包含关系 1)、示例 2)、使用场景 3、术语 4、扩展关系 如果某个用例文本因为某些原因不能被修改,但是,业务要修改,怎么办?答:创建扩展或附加用例,并且在其中指明扩展点,即:在何处、何种条件下触发扩展用例 ...
分类:
其他好文 时间:
2019-08-27 19:38:31
阅读次数:
93
定义 对象之间定义一对多的依赖,当 这个对象状态发生变化,它所依赖的对象都能得到变化后的状态值。(简单的来说,就类似消息系统的发布订阅模式。其中消息系统中的 就是 ,消息系统中的 就是被观察者。当生产者的状态发生变化,那么订阅该消息的消费者就将全部接收到变化的信息) 类图 说明 由UML可以看出,该 ...
分类:
其他好文 时间:
2019-08-26 14:55:56
阅读次数:
63
Maven 项目使用mybatis的环境搭建-基于xml形式实现查询所有的功能 M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射 ...
分类:
其他好文 时间:
2019-08-26 10:04:18
阅读次数:
80
类型推论: 如果没有明确的指定类型,那么 TypeScript 会依照类型推论(Type Inference)的规则推断出一个类型。 什么是类型推论 以下代码虽然没有指定类型,但是会在编译的时候报错: let myFavoriteNumber = 'seven'; myFavoriteNumber ...
分类:
其他好文 时间:
2019-08-21 15:06:03
阅读次数:
74
[toc] 微生物来源分析 写在前面 最近由于老板有分析项目,我实在是进展缓慢,一直苦恼并艰难的探索和进展,所以很长时间没有和大家见面了,今天我为大家带来的source tracker分析,使用前一段时间刚出来的工具FEAST。 刘老师对这片文章进行了详细的解读: "Nature Methods:快 ...
分类:
其他好文 时间:
2019-08-19 19:08:40
阅读次数:
531
(一)本周工作内容: 本周对统一建模语言UML进一步学习了解到了用例图,对象图,顺序图等内容,同时学习了JAVA语言多态这一第三大特性。 (二)下周工作计划: 继续完成PTA上的题目,并继续学习JAVA语言的进阶内容。 (三)本周问题: 在完成PTA上的题目时对C++语言的运用不太流畅。 ...
分类:
其他好文 时间:
2019-08-18 22:15:29
阅读次数:
118
工欲善其事,必先利其器,好的工具可以提升我们的开发效率,下面介绍几款个人觉得比较好的编辑器插件,不仅炫酷更重要可以提高你的工作效率。 本文是作者辛苦整理的16款插件,每个都是超级实用的,不好不介绍,相信体验过后才知道它的好。 Activate-power-mode 插件 我喜欢称这个插件叫,“会跳舞 ...
分类:
其他好文 时间:
2019-08-17 14:15:36
阅读次数:
70
1、 服务器端 没有客户端连接时的运行结果 有客户端连接时的运行结果(当然你得先写客户端,直接看客户端代码吧) 2、 客户端 运行结果 温馨提示 : 1、 一般模拟服务端和客户端,我采用的方法是用 eclipse 运行服务端(你也可以用你的编译工具运行),再用 cmd 运行客户端,这样很形象就能看出 ...
分类:
编程语言 时间:
2019-08-15 15:56:20
阅读次数:
85